Heracles Analysis & Past Performance

Heracles have delivered mixed results in recent matches. Over their last five fixtures, they have recorded three wins and two defeats, giving them a 60% win ratio. Their attack has been potent, averaging 2.80 goals per game, with standout performances such as the 8–2 demolition of PEC Zwolle and a 4–1 victory over NAC Breda in the KNVB Cup.

Despite their attacking strengths, Heracles have struggled defensively, conceding an average of 3.00 goals per game in their last five outings. This defensive frailty is evident in their failure to keep a clean sheet during this period. At home, their form mirrors their overall record, with two wins and three losses from the last five home games, reflecting a 40% win ratio. Currently at the bottom of the Eredivisie with 9 points, their defensive issues remain a critical concern.

Heracles Suspensions & Injuries

Heracles are dealing with several key absences due to injury. Sem Scheperman is out until early January 2026 with a hamstring injury, which will significantly affect the midfield. Jeff Reine-Adélaïde and Tristan van Gilst are both doubtful with a knee injury and a knock respectively, further limiting options in midfield and attack. Sava Čestić’s broken ankle also leaves a gap in defence, potentially weakening Heracles’ back line against Go Ahead Eagles.

These unavailabilities are likely to force coach Hendrie Krüzen to consider alternative options. With Bryan Limbombe and Ajdin Hrustić available, there is some quality to fill the midfield void, but the absence of Reine-Adélaïde’s creativity could be felt. Defensive responsibilities may fall more heavily on Mike te Wierik and Damon Mirani to provide stability at the back.

Go Ahead Eagles Analysis & Past Performance

Go Ahead Eagles have also produced mixed results recently, with three wins and two defeats in their last five matches. Their recent 2–1 victory over Feyenoord, achieved with only 40% possession, highlighted their ability to overcome strong opponents through resilience and tactical discipline.

The team averages 1.20 goals per game over their last five matches, while conceding 1.00 on average, pointing to a balanced approach. However, their away form is a concern, with just one win in their last five away fixtures (a 20% win rate). They have failed to keep a clean sheet on the road during this period, exposing a potential vulnerability.

Go Ahead Eagles Suspensions & Injuries

Go Ahead Eagles are also contending with several key injuries. Pim Saathof and Victor Edvardsen are both doubtful with knee injuries for the upcoming match against Heracles. Gerrit Nauber’s leg injury further weakens the defence, while Jakob Breum Martinsen is rated day-to-day. The absence of Sören Tengstedt, whose injury details remain unspecified, further complicates matters in attack. This series of injuries could significantly impact the team’s tactical plans, particularly in maintaining defensive solidity and attacking fluidity.

Heracles vs Go Ahead Eagles Head-to-Head Record

The head-to-head record between Heracles and Go Ahead Eagles is closely contested, with Heracles winning 12 times and Go Ahead Eagles 11, along with three draws. Their most recent meeting saw Heracles win 4–2 in the Eredivisie, demonstrating their attacking strength at home.

In Eredivisie encounters, the record remains tight, with both sides trading victories. Heracles have a slight advantage at home, but Go Ahead Eagles have proven capable of causing upsets, notably with their 4–1 win in October 2024.
